Ryans: If rose the balance starts with we can't hang our head on past success. My past success is not gonna, you know, automatically guarantee you future success. So we got to go out and we have to earn it. And that's one thing that Josh and his offense is gonna make you do they're gonna make you earn every play that you make. And that's how we like it. That's how we should be and our guys are up for that challenge. We know we have to cover longer than we do versus other quarterbacks. You got the rush a little bit longer just knowing it's not it's not gonna happen as quick as other teams. It's just got to take time guys have to be patient. You have to make sure you're plastering and coverage being responsible being where you're supposed to be. When you do that, you have opportunities to make plays or Josh is a good player. He's gonna make some plays but we have to just find a way to make more than he makes.

Unknown: Knowing the last couple of weeks there's been speeches you go to the team that have a NASA theme to it. Yeah, is there something you have planned this week coming with week one with another something with with NASA involved as well?

Ryans: For me it's you know it started with the NASA build-up with NASA being in our backyard here in Houston and just really wanted to tie the two together, right because Houston is about community Houston is about us being together. So it was a thought it was a really good way to correlate us preparing right for training camp getting ready just like Artemis 2 they prepare they got ready. It took them time right for that build up and for that moment and now, you know come Sunday it's time for the takeoff and that's the next part of the message. Hey, how are we taking off on Sunday?

Unknown: So some of the guys were talking about how you had them eat and lunch with each other like defense well offense tight ends linebackers, whatever did you get involved in that at all? Is there anything that you learned especially unique different about somebody you didn't know?

Ryans: Yeah, the biggest thing for for me and training camp is how do you like force that interaction amongst the player? Right and now is the main thing is it's getting different. It's easy for the linebackers to always eat together with linebackers. They meet together. So you just kind of have to force that interaction and I'm happy our guys, you know, it took it serious. Well, we had our breakout sessions of different groups eating lunch together meeting together just getting to dive in and learn each other a little bit better. I think that was beneficial towards our growth as a team for 2026 and I feel like our guys gained a lot of insight from that.
